Loved the location- we parked 400m outside the town gate and walked in 50 m inside the gate following the YouTube instructions. Easy!
The house is spacious with three levels.
Level one you walk into off the path and is a huge double bedroom and sofa sitting area. You must pass through this room to get to the lower levels stairs.
It wasn’t a privacy issue for us though as the other person had their room on level two and then they only went down to kitchen/bathroom at night.
Level two is one double bedroom with door.
Level three down the bottom is a large lounge area with more sofa beds and a kitchen table. The kitchen is off this and then the small bathroom is off the kitchen. There is also a door to get outside to a lower path on the bottom floor.
The views out the windows are lovely, rooftops and bougainvillea.
Two minutes walk to cafes shops and restaurants. We were there in the rain and you must have good footwear for the rocky pathways and stairs that are all over the island.
